A security alert in Derry-Londonderry has ended.
The alarm was raised yesterday evening following the discovery of a suspicious object near a bus stop on the Moss road.
Army bomb experts examined the device and declared it to be elaborate hoax.

Local councillor Aileen Mellon said:
“The security alert at Moss Road is now over. "
“This has caused major disruption and inconvenience for the local community tonight. "
“Thanks to local youth workers who have been engaging with young people and supporting residents tonight. "
“Those responsible have nothing to offer and should stop.”
